What Are the Umrah Visa Options in 2025 for Pakistanis?

Can Pakistanis Perform Umrah on a Tourist Visa in 2025?

Yes!
In 2025, Pakistanis can still perform Umrah on a Saudi Tourist Visa — and it’s becoming the preferred option for many.

Here’s a quick comparison:

Visa Type Purpose Processing Time Validity Approx Cost
Umrah Visa Only for Umrah 7–10 days 30 days Rs. 35,000–45,000
Tourist Visa Umrah + Tourism 24–72 hours (e-Visa) 1 year (Multiple entry) Rs. 30,000–40,000

What Is the Total Cost of Umrah from Pakistan in 2025?

The cost of Umrah depends on your city, travel date, hotel choice, and visa type. But to give you a reliable estimate, here’s a breakdown:

Item Budget Range (per person)
Visa Fee Rs. 30,000 – 45,000
Air Ticket (Roundtrip) Rs. 95,000 – 160,000
Hotel (7 nights) Rs. 45,000 – 95,000
Transport (within KSA) Rs. 10,000 – 20,000
Food & Misc Rs. 10,000 – 15,000

👉 Total Estimated Cost:
Rs. 190,000 to 320,000 per person

Expert Tip:
Booking early or traveling off-season (after Ramadan or before winter) can save you up to 25%.

What Are the Requirements for Umrah 2025 from Pakistan?

To apply for Umrah in 2025, you’ll need:

  1. A valid Pakistani passport (6+ months validity)
  2. CNIC copy
  3. 2 passport-sized photos (white background)
  4. Confirmed hotel booking
  5. Confirmed return ticket
  6. Vaccination certificate (especially Meningitis, COVID-19 if required)

What Are the Best Umrah Packages for 2025 from Pakistan?

You’ll find various travel agencies offering group and custom Umrah packages.

Here’s a summary of popular options:

Package Type Duration Hotel Category Estimated Cost
Budget Package 7 days 3-star (shared room) Rs. 195,000
Standard Package 10 days 4-star (twin sharing) Rs. 255,000
VIP Package 14 days 5-star (near Haram) Rs. 395,000

People Also Ask:

What’s the difference between a group Umrah and a solo Umrah package?

A group Umrah is guided, often more affordable, and includes transportation with fellow pilgrims.
Solo Umrah gives you complete flexibility in travel dates and hotel choices, but it might cost a bit more.

Can You Perform Umrah Without a Travel Agent in 2025?

Yes — and it’s getting easier.
Thanks to the Saudi eVisa system and platforms like Nusuk.sa, you can now book:

  1. Your own visa
  2. Hotels
  3. Local transport
  4. Even get Umrah permits (if required)

What Are Some Things to Watch Out for in 2025?

  • Overcharging agents: Always compare prices from at least 2–3 agencies.

  • Hidden fees: Ask upfront — does the package include visa, hotel taxes, transport?

  • Unauthorized operators: Use only SECP-registered and IATA-certified agents in Pakistan.

FAQs: 

1. How much does Umrah cost from Pakistan in 2025?

It ranges from Rs. 190,000 to Rs. 320,000 depending on your package, visa type, and travel preferences.

2. Can I apply for an Umrah visa online in 2025?

Yes, through authorized platforms or travel agents. Tourist visas can also be obtained via Saudi’s official portal.

3. Is a COVID-19 vaccine still required for Umrah in 2025?

As of now, it’s not mandatory, but Meningitis vaccine is still required. Always confirm latest health updates before travel.

4. How many days should I stay for Umrah?

Most Pakistanis stay 7–10 days, but some VIP packages go up to 14 days for a relaxed experience.

5. What are the cheapest months to go for Umrah in 2025?

Avoid Ramadan and Hajj season. January–March and September–November are usually cheaper.
